Note implementation finished with status 'Incompletely implemented'

Former Member
0 Likes
16,623

When applying note 1736533 on GRC System, the note log shows that the correction instruction is 'completely implemented', but the implementation status of the Sap Note remains 'Incompletely implemented'.

I checked the corrections and the corresponding changes are already in source code, all programs are active and already executed the post-implementation steps, but the implementation status doens't change.


Someone already faced this situation or have a tip to solve this?

thanks in advance

In case you have not found your issue yet, I believe Note 1685578 will solve your issue.

There is an issue (bug) in SNOTE with the SAP_BASIS 702 0012 SAPKB70212 SAP Basis Component which this note solved for me.

Hi ,

It seems like this note contains some manual correction which is not available via SNOTE but we can validate the same in sap service market place .

Please check the note in service market place as well and implement the prerequisite and manual corrections before going ahead with implementing the note.

MTXT seems to be coming in such scenarios when the SNOTE is not able to convert the instructions .

Hope it helps.,
